Arunis Abode Limited has completed its Rights Issue, allotting 4,80,00,000 (4.8 crore) fully paid-up equity shares to eligible shareholders at Rs. 12.60 per share (face value Rs. 10, premium Rs. 2.60). The total issue size is Rs. 6,048 lakhs (about Rs. 60.48 crore). The offer opened on September 3, 2025 and closed on September 11, 2025, with the committee finalising the allotment on September 12, 2025. Post-issue, the company's paid-up share capital jumps from 30 lakh shares (Rs. 3 crore) to 5.1 crore shares (Rs. 51 crore) — a 17-fold increase, which is highly dilutive for shareholders who did not subscribe. The issue price carries only a modest premium over face value, suggesting the company was keen to ensure subscription by keeping pricing attractive.
Existing shareholders who did not exercise their rights face a sharp dilution of roughly 94% in their ownership stake. For those who subscribed, the cost was Rs. 12.60 per share. The stock price may see pressure as the large new float becomes tradable, though the low premium pricing may limit downside if the capital is put to productive use.
